New Diagnostic Technologies
Lately, there have been big improvements in diagnostic technologies for small animal internal medicine. Veterinarians now have access to tools like MRI and CT scans to diagnose and treat pets more accurately. These new technologies have changed the way we handle internal medicine in small animals.
Precision Medicine
Precision medicine is another exciting advancement in small animal internal medicine. This approach customizes medical treatment based on the individual characteristics of each animal. With precision medicine, veterinarians can provide more targeted and effective treatments, leading to better outcomes and improved quality of life for small animals. Minimally Invasive Procedures
New minimally invasive procedures like laparoscopy and endoscopy have made a big impact on small animal internal medicine. These techniques allow for complex procedures with minimal trauma to the patient, resulting in faster recovery times and less post-operative pain.
Integrated Approach to Care
There’s a growing trend towards an integrated approach to care in small animal internal medicine. This means that veterinarians, specialists, and other healthcare professionals work together as a team to provide comprehensive and coordinated medical care for small animals with complex internal medical conditions.
Education and Training
As the field of small animal internal medicine evolves, there’s a bigger focus on education and training for veterinary professionals. Continuing education programs and advanced training courses help veterinarians and vet techs stay updated with the latest developments in internal medicine for small animals.
